Senior Partner at Law Firm Suspended for Drunken Remarks at Christmas Party

A senior partner at a prominent law firm has been suspended from practicing law for one year after making inappropriate drunken sexual remarks to four women during a Christmas party. The incident raises concerns about workplace conduct and accountability in the legal profession.

What happened

The senior partner, whose identity has not been disclosed, was reported to have made several offensive comments while attending the firm's holiday gathering. The remarks were directed at multiple female colleagues and were deemed unacceptable by the firm's leadership. Following an internal investigation, the decision to suspend the partner was made to address the violation of professional conduct standards.
